A rounded, monoline sans with smooth curves and softly finished terminals. The forms lean toward geometric construction—circular bowls and open apertures—while keeping a slightly human, informal rhythm through gentle stroke joins and simplified details. Counters are generous and the overall spacing feels even, producing dark, steady text color without sharp corners or high-contrast stress.
Well-suited for interface typography, product branding, and short-to-medium headlines where a friendly modern tone is desired. The smooth, rounded construction also works nicely on packaging and wayfinding/signage applications that benefit from clear, soft-edged letterforms.
The tone is warm and accessible, with a contemporary friendliness that avoids both strict technical austerity and overt quirk. Its rounded shaping gives it a casual, inviting voice suited to upbeat messaging and everyday interfaces.
The design appears intended to deliver a contemporary, readable sans with rounded friendliness—balancing clean geometric structure with softened details for a more approachable, consumer-facing feel.
Uppercase and lowercase maintain consistent stroke logic and corner rounding, creating a cohesive family feel in mixed-case settings. Numerals are similarly rounded and sturdy, reading clearly at display sizes while retaining a soft, approachable character.
